Yarden Gerbi is a retired Israeli judoka world champion and Olympic bronze medalist. She is one of the most successful judoka fighters in Israeli history, winning the national championship five-times by the age of 24. In 2013, Gerbi won a gold medal in the World Judo Championship, and a few years later she won an Olympic bronze medal competing for Israel at the 2016 Summer Olympics. Gerbi retired from the sport at the 2017 Maccabiah Games and has since received a degree in economics and management from the Open University of Israel.
